Booze Ban on Beaches

Last night was the second reading of the alcohol ban on San Diego beaches and therefore the ban will go into effect in 30 days, December 20th. I think it is a good thing. I have seen how the alcohol makes things get a little crazy and out of hand at the beaches and I am glad that families will be able to feel a little more comfortable on the beaches in the coming months (and hopefully no more riots like on Labor Day). 1-year beach booze ban passed

No more wine at the beach at sunset. No more cold brews on the coast after work. No more of the drunken revelry that led to a near riot on Labor Day.

That's what the San Diego City Council decided last night, passing a one-year ban on alcohol at all city beaches, bay shores and coastal parks. The 5-2 vote, the minimum needed for passage, came after nearly four hours of debate and speeches by scores of residents and City Council members.
